.layout-startpage .content-wrapper .content-top-banner h1, .layout-startpage .content-wrapper .content-top-banner .h1 {font-size: 1.7rem;}.layout-startpage .content-wrapper .content-top-banner .bg-transparent .container {max-width:100%;background:rgba(0,40,86,0.6);margin-top: 8rem;}    	.layout-startpage .content-wrapper .content-top-banner .bg-transparent .container > div {
      		max-width: 1140px; 
      		margin: 0 auto;
      		padding: 0 15px;
      	}
        @media (min-width:576px) {
    		.layout-startpage .content-wrapper .content-top-banner .bg-transparent .container > div {max-width: 540px;}
		}
      	@media (min-width:768px) {
    		.layout-startpage .content-wrapper .content-top-banner .bg-transparent .container > div {max-width: 720px;}
		}  
      	@media (min-width:992px) {
    		.layout-startpage .content-wrapper .content-top-banner .bg-transparent .container > div {max-width: 960px;}
		}  
      	@media (min-width:1200px) {
    		.layout-startpage .content-wrapper .content-top-banner .bg-transparent .container > div {max-width: 1140px;}
		}.layout-startpage .bg-transparent .btn, .layout-startpage .header-right-inner .btn, .btn {border-radius: 15px !important;}.header-wrapper .header-middle .press-link {text-transform: uppercase;}      	.layout-startpage .content-main-container .ge-inlineimage-content .bg-transparent {
      		padding-top: 0 !important;
      	}
    	.layout-startpage .content-main-container .ge-inlineimage-content .frame-box-transparent {
    		margin-bottom: 0px;
    		background: rgba(0,40,84,0.6);
    		padding: 5rem 25px;
			margin-right: 5rem;
		}
		.layout-startpage .content-main-container .ge-inlineimage-content .bg-transparent .container .mb-3 { 
        	margin-bottom:0 !important;
        }
		@media (max-width:991px) {
          	.layout-startpage .content-wrapper .content-top-banner .bg-transparent .container {
            	margin-top: 8rem;
            }
            .layout-startpage .content-wrapper .content-top-banner .bg-transparent .container .frame-padding-before-medium {
                padding-top: 1rem;
            }          
            .layout-startpage .content-wrapper .content-top-banner .bg-transparent .container .lead {
    			font-size: 1.0rem;
            }
			.layout-startpage .content-main-container .ge-inlineimage-content .frame-box-transparent {
          		margin-right: 0rem;
        	}
        }
		@media (max-width:767px) {
          	.layout-startpage .content-wrapper .content-top-banner .bg-transparent .container {
            	margin-top: 14rem;
            }
        }
		@media (max-width:539px) {
          	.layout-startpage .content-wrapper .content-top-banner .bg-transparent .container {
            	margin-top: 12rem;
            }
        }
		@media (max-width:479px) {
          	.layout-startpage .content-wrapper .content-top-banner .bg-transparent .container {
            	margin-top: 10rem;
            }
        }